Silly Season: Thea Krokan Murud Leaving Lager 157 Ski Team

by Leandro Lutz • 25.05.2022
Today, Lager 157 Ski Team announced that the Pro Tour skier Thea Krokan Murud is leaving the Swedish Pro Team.

Thea Krokan Murud stepped on the podium three times during the last Ski Classics season. She was 2nd at Tartu Maraton, 3rd at Jizerská50, 3rd at Ylläs-Levi, and finished Season XII in the 11th place overall at the Champion competition, 7th in the Sprint, and 6th place overall in the Climb competition.

Lager 157 Ski Team Instagram:

“We thank @theamurud for her time on the team. We would love to see Thea continue on the team. We thank and wish you good luck.”

The future for Thea Krokan Murud has yet to be revealed.
